If you drive an electric car and regularly use charging stations managed by PowerFlex, this app is worth a closer look. I found it most useful as a practical companion for starting a charge, checking what is happening, and avoiding the uncertainty that comes with leaving a vehicle connected in an unfamiliar place. It is a free Auto & Vehicles app from PowerFlex, rated for Everyone, and its main purpose is simple: helping drivers use PowerFlex Adaptive Charging Stations from a phone.
The important distinction is that this is not a general-purpose electric vehicle planner or a replacement for every charging network’s application. Its value depends on whether the station you want to use belongs to the PowerFlex system. When that match exists, the app can make the charging visit feel more organized than relying on a payment terminal, a printed instruction sheet, or several unrelated charging apps. When it does not, the app is naturally much less useful.

Where new users can become confused
The biggest possible source of confusion is the difference between the app and the charger itself. PowerFlex can provide the digital route into a charging session, but it cannot correct a damaged connector, a blocked parking bay, a vehicle that has not accepted the plug, or a station that is temporarily unavailable. When something goes wrong, I separate the problem into three questions: is the station accessible, is the car physically connected, and has the app recognized the intended charging point?
Location names and station identifiers deserve attention too. At a large property, multiple chargers may be close together, and choosing the wrong one can make the app appear unresponsive even when another point is available. I compare the identifier shown in the app with the label on the station before starting. This is a small but non-obvious safeguard that saves time in shared parking areas.
It is also easy to confuse “connected” with “finished.” A cable may remain attached after the vehicle has stopped receiving energy, and a user may assume that leaving it there is harmless. I check the session status before walking away and again before leaving the site. If the location has its own parking etiquette, I follow that as well. Being considerate to the next driver is part of using a shared charging network properly.
Another point I keep in mind is that an app rating reflects the overall experience of many users, not the exact conditions at my current station. PowerFlex’s 4.8 average is encouraging, but signal strength, site design, vehicle compatibility, and local access rules can still affect a particular visit. I judge the app fairly by whether it gives me a workable digital path, while recognizing that charging is a combined system of software, hardware, car, and parking location.
If the app does not seem to show the expected station, I would first confirm the network name and location rather than assuming the phone is broken. This is where a general charging map can be a useful companion. It may help identify other nearby networks, but I would not expect it to replace the PowerFlex workflow at a PowerFlex-managed station. The two tools have different jobs: one helps me plan broadly, and the other helps me interact with a particular network.
